Saudi Arabia Freight and Logistics Market Outlook

According to the report by Expert Market Research (EMR), the Saudi Arabia freight and logistics market size reached a value of USD 31.82 billion in 2023. Driven by the kingdom’s strategic geographical location, expanding infrastructure, and growing trade activities, the market is poised to grow further at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.5% between 2024 and 2032, reaching a projected value of around USD 51.60 billion by 2032.

The freight and logistics industry in Saudi Arabia has experienced significant transformation, driven by the kingdom’s ambitious Vision 2030 plan, which aims to diversify the economy beyond oil and establish Saudi Arabia as a global logistics hub. This initiative has propelled massive infrastructure investments in transport networks, including roads, ports, and airports, improving the efficiency and capacity of the logistics sector. Saudi Arabia’s location at the crossroads of major international trade routes further enhances its strategic importance, providing access to key markets in the Middle East, Europe, Asia, and Africa.

Key Market Drivers

A critical factor boosting the growth of the Saudi Arabia freight and logistics market is the country’s commitment to modernising its transportation infrastructure. The Saudi government has initiated several mega-projects, including the development of new airports, seaports, and road networks. These investments are designed to facilitate the smooth movement of goods and services, reducing transportation costs and improving delivery times. Notable projects include the expansion of King Abdulaziz Port, the construction of the King Salman Energy Park, and the development of logistics zones around key industrial areas.

The logistics sector is further supported by the rise of e-commerce in Saudi Arabia, which has significantly increased demand for efficient logistics and delivery services. The rapid adoption of online shopping, driven by a tech-savvy population and expanding digital infrastructure, has created new growth opportunities for logistics companies. E-commerce platforms and retailers require robust and responsive supply chains to manage the rising volume of online orders, ensuring timely deliveries across the kingdom’s vast territory.

Saudi Arabia’s burgeoning industrial base is another key driver of the logistics market. With the kingdom aiming to diversify its economy and reduce its dependence on oil, sectors such as manufacturing, mining, and petrochemicals are expanding. These industries require sophisticated logistics networks to support the transportation of raw materials, intermediate goods, and finished products. Moreover, the government’s focus on increasing non-oil exports has created a growing demand for freight services, both within the country and for international shipments.

Road Freight Segment Dominates the Market

The road freight segment holds a significant share of the Saudi Arabia freight and logistics market, owing to the extensive road network that spans the kingdom. Road transportation is the most common mode of freight movement, particularly for domestic trade. The vast network of highways, connecting major cities and industrial zones, enables efficient transportation of goods across the country. Additionally, the growing demand for just-in-time (JIT) delivery and last-mile services, particularly in the e-commerce sector, has further enhanced the importance of road freight.

The expansion of road infrastructure, as part of the Vision 2030 initiative, has improved connectivity across the kingdom, enabling faster and more reliable transportation. Furthermore, technological advancements, such as the use of GPS tracking and fleet management systems, have enhanced the efficiency and transparency of road freight services, allowing logistics companies to optimise routes, reduce fuel consumption, and minimise delays.

Seaborne Freight and Port Development

Seaborne freight is another essential component of Saudi Arabia freight and logistics market, with the country’s strategic position along key maritime trade routes playing a pivotal role. Saudi Arabia is home to some of the largest and busiest ports in the region, including King Abdullah Port and Jeddah Islamic Port, which serve as critical gateways for international trade. The country’s ports are vital for the import and export of goods, particularly oil, petrochemicals, and manufactured products.

To support the growing demand for maritime logistics, the Saudi government has invested heavily in upgrading its port infrastructure, increasing capacity, and improving operational efficiency. The expansion of ports such as King Abdulaziz Port in Dammam and the development of new logistics zones around these ports are aimed at attracting global shipping lines and logistics providers, positioning Saudi Arabia as a major player in global trade.

The growth of the petrochemical industry, which requires the export of large volumes of products, further drives the demand for seaborne freight. Saudi Arabia’s vast oil reserves, combined with its ambitions to become a leader in petrochemical production, have made maritime logistics an integral part of the country’s supply chain strategy.

Challenges Facing the Market

Despite the promising outlook, the Saudi Arabia freight and logistics market faces several challenges. One of the primary concerns is the reliance on oil revenue, which can create economic volatility and impact government spending on infrastructure projects. While Vision 2030 aims to diversify the economy, fluctuations in global oil prices may affect the pace of development in the logistics sector.

Another challenge is the regulatory environment, which can create barriers to market entry for foreign logistics providers. Although the Saudi government has taken steps to liberalise the market and attract foreign investment, bureaucratic hurdles and complex customs procedures can pose difficulties for international companies seeking to establish a presence in the kingdom.

Environmental sustainability is also an emerging issue for the logistics industry in Saudi Arabia. As global pressure mounts to reduce carbon emissions, logistics providers in the country are increasingly required to adopt greener practices. This includes investing in fuel-efficient vehicles, reducing energy consumption in warehouses, and utilising renewable energy sources. However, the transition to sustainable logistics practices may be slow, given the country’s reliance on traditional fuel sources.

Future Prospects and Opportunities

Looking ahead, the Saudi Arabia freight and logistics market is expected to continue its upward trajectory, driven by government investments, technological advancements, and the expansion of key industries. The kingdom’s Vision 2030 provides a clear roadmap for transforming Saudi Arabia into a global logistics hub, with substantial opportunities for both domestic and international logistics providers.

Technological innovation will play a central role in shaping the future of the market. The adoption of digital platforms, blockchain technology, and artificial intelligence (AI) will enhance the efficiency of logistics operations, enabling real-time tracking of shipments, reducing administrative bottlenecks, and improving supply chain visibility. Furthermore, the growing focus on automation and robotics in warehousing and distribution centres will drive operational efficiencies and reduce labour costs.

The rise of e-commerce, combined with the increasing demand for fast and reliable delivery services, presents significant growth opportunities for logistics companies. As the e-commerce sector continues to expand, logistics providers will need to invest in last-mile delivery solutions, fulfilment centres, and digital platforms to meet the evolving needs of consumers.
